CHECKING/REPLACING PADS

The clearance between the brake pads and brake discs is
adjusted automatically as the brake pads wear. The only
maintenance that is required is replacement of the brake
pads when they show excessive wear. Check the thick-
ness of each of the brake pads as follows.
1. Remove a front wheel.
2. Measure the thickness of each brake pad.
3. If thickness of either brake pad is less than 1.0 mm
(0.039 in.), the brake pads must be replaced.
NOTE: The brake pads should be replaced as a
set.
4. To replace the brake pads, use the following proce-
dure.
A. Remove the cap screws securing the caliper
holder to the knuckle; then remove the pads.
B. Install the new brake pads.
C. Secure the caliper to the knuckle and/or axle
housing with the cap screws. Tighten to 20 ft-lb.
5. Install the wheel. Tighten to 40 ft-lb.
6. Burnish the brake pads (see Burnishing Brake Pads
in this section).

Burnishing Brake Pads

Brake pads must be burnished to achieve full braking
effectiveness. Braking distance will be extended until
brake pads are properly burnished. To properly burnish

the brake pads, use the following procedure.
Failure to properly burnish the brake pads could lead to
premature brake pad wear or brake loss. Brake loss can
result in severe injury.
1. Choose an area large enough to safely accelerate the
ATV to 30 mph and to brake to a stop.
2. Accelerate to 30 mph; then compress brake levers or
brake pedal to decelerate to 0-5 mph.
3. Repeat procedure on each brake system twenty
times.
4. Verify the brakelights illuminate when the hand lever
is compressed or the brake pedal is depressed.
